(CMR) Five US military helicopters that drew the attention of people across Grand Cayman on Tuesday stopped for refueling, CMR has learned.
The two heavy-lift Chinooks and three Black Hawks stayed at the airport overnight and are expected to head to Guantánamo Bay, Cuba, today. CMR understands the helicopters will be available to provide humanitarian assistance to Haiti.
Gangs have created havoc in Haiti, shutting down its international airport and forcing the US to evacuate embassy personnel using its military. The US also sent additional security to the embassy.
“At the request of the Department of State, the U.S. military conducted an operation to augment the security of the U.S. Embassy at Port-au-Prince, allow our Embassy mission operations to continue, and enable non-essential personnel to depart,” U.S. Southern Command said in a statement to USA TODAY.
No Haitians were evacuated on the aircraft used to remove US embassy personnel.
